Antennas

There’s a thing called a butterfly antenna. It looks like two triangles laid tip to tip, and it’s symmetric.

It is impossible to search for, because butterflies, the insects, have antennas. The entomology world loves taking pictures of butterfly antennas, talking about them, analyzing them, and pushing images of butterfly antennas to children like aggressive science pushers.

So you have to look for something called a bowtie antenna.

It looks nothing like a bowtie.

The only good part of this is that searching lead me to the log periodic antenna, which looks like it’s even better!
